Folks, we've got a real barnburner of a matchup for you in the MLS, but let's be real, it's all about the Philadelphia Union's ability to survive without their A-team. I mean, they're missing five key players, including their star goalkeeper Andre Blake and defender Nathan Harriel, who are off gallivanting in the Concacaf Gold Cup. Not to mention, Tai Baribo and Mikael Uhre are out with injuries. It's like they're playing a game of MLS musical chairs, and poor Cavan Sullivan (Quinn's little brother) might just get stuck holding the bag.

Despite this, the Union is riding a 12-match unbeaten streak across all competitions, and they're sitting pretty with a four-point lead in the Eastern Conference. But let's not forget, Charlotte FC is looking to make a push for the top seven, and they're not going to gift wrap it to Philly.

The odds are telling us that Philadelphia Union is the favorite to win at home, with a price ranging from 1.76 to 1.82 across various bookmakers. Charlotte FC is the underdog, with odds between 3.85 and 4.4. A draw? That's a possibility, with prices hovering around 3.8 to 4.0.

Now, let's crunch some numbers. Historically, underdogs in MLS have a win rate of around 32%. But given Philadelphia's current form and the fact that they're missing key players, I'm not convinced they'll steamroll Charlotte FC.

The most likely outcome, according to data analysis, is a Philadelphia Union win with a probability of 50.42%. The predicted scoreline for a Philadelphia Union win is 2-1 with a probability of 9.58%.
